The YDK250-4H is a high-performance commercial kitchen exhaust motor delivering 250W of robust power for demanding restaurant and commercial kitchen ventilation applications. Featuring a stainless steel SUS303 shaft, Class B insulation, and a totally enclosed fan-cooled design, this centrifugal motor handles the high static pressure, elevated temperatures, and grease-laden air typical of commercial kitchen environments. Heavy-duty ball bearings ensure reliable continuous operation.
| Model | YDK250-4H |
|---|---|
| Motor Type | Single Phase Capacitor Run Centrifugal |
| Power | 250W |
| Speed | 1400RPM |
| Voltage | 220V/50Hz (380V three-phase optional) |
| Insulation Class | Class B |
| Shaft Material | Stainless Steel SUS303 |
| Bearing | Heavy-Duty Ball Bearing |
| Protection | Thermal Overload Protected |
| Noise Level | ≤55dB(A) |
| Enclosure | Totally Enclosed Fan Cooled |
- 250W centrifugal design delivers high static pressure for commercial duct systems
- SUS303 stainless steel shaft resists corrosion from grease and moisture
- Class B insulation rated for elevated temperature kitchen environments
- Totally enclosed fan-cooled enclosure prevents grease and contaminant ingress
- Heavy-duty ball bearings for 24/7 continuous operation reliability
- Thermal overload protection prevents motor damage in fault conditions
- Available in both single-phase and three-phase configurations
